Wedding Invitations in Australia: Templates & Trends
Planning a wedding in Australia involves a lot of choices, and your wedding invitations are a crucial first impression. Using templates can be a fantastic way to save time and money while still achieving a beautiful and personalized result.
Why Use Wedding Invitation Templates?
- Cost-Effective: Templates are significantly cheaper than custom-designed invitations.
- Time-Saving: Avoid lengthy design processes and proofing rounds.
- Variety: A wide range of styles are available, from classic to modern.
- Customizable: Most templates allow you to change fonts, colors, and wording.
- Print Options: You can print them at home, use an online printing service, or a local printer.
Popular Wedding Invitation Styles in Australia
Australian wedding styles often reflect the natural beauty of the country. Here are some trending themes:
- Botanical/Floral: Featuring eucalyptus, native wildflowers, and leafy greenery.
- Rustic/Boho: Incorporating kraft paper, lace, wood textures, and earthy tones.
- Modern Minimalist: Clean lines, simple fonts, and a focus on typography.
- Coastal/Beach: Shades of blue, sea shells, and imagery of the ocean.
- Classic/Elegant: Traditional fonts, formal wording, and luxurious paper stock.
Where to Find Wedding Invitation Templates
Many online platforms offer downloadable or customizable wedding invitation templates. Here are some popular options:
- Etsy: A marketplace with a wide selection of unique and handcrafted templates from independent designers.
- Canva: A user-friendly design platform with a large library of free and paid templates.
- Templett: Specifically designed for editable templates; purchase a design and edit directly in your browser.
- Vistaprint & Officeworks: Offer online design tools and printing services.
- Local Australian Stationery Designers: Some offer template options alongside custom design services.
Customizing Your Template
Once you’ve chosen a template, personalize it to reflect your wedding details and style:
- Wording: Use a template as a starting point but tailor the wording to your personalities and preferences. Include all essential information: date, time, location, dress code, and RSVP details.
- Fonts & Colors: Experiment with different font pairings and color palettes to match your wedding theme.
- Paper Stock: Choose a high-quality paper that feels luxurious and complements the design. Consider textured paper, cardstock, or recycled options.
- Envelopes: Don’t forget to select matching envelopes that complement the invitation design.
- Embellishments: Consider adding a personal touch with ribbon, twine, wax seals, or other embellishments.
Australian Wedding Invitation Etiquette
Remember to follow proper wedding invitation etiquette:
- Timing: Send invitations 6-8 weeks before the wedding date.
- RSVP: Include a clear RSVP deadline (3-4 weeks before the wedding).
- Addressing: Address envelopes formally, especially for classic weddings.
- Plus Ones: Be clear about whether guests are invited with a plus one.
